我正在尝试使用 XNA 制作我的第一个应用程序,但我在方向和坐标方面遇到了一些问题。
默认情况下,我的手机模拟器是竖屏模式,但是右上角是(0,0),X和Y好像是切换的。从我对它们的期望(x 上升,y 跨越)
在我的代码中,我尝试更改方向类似于
SupportedOrientations = SupportedPageOrientation.Portrait;
SupportedOrientations.FullScreen = true;
当我这样做时,它解决了我遇到的坐标问题,但是屏幕变成了一个小正方形。
任何想法如何解决这一问题?这就是它应该的样子吗?
另外,方向会自动改变,还是我需要明确添加
private void PhoneApplicationPage_OrientationChanging
(object sender,OrientationChangedEventArgs e)
谢谢